  • Abstract
    The method of the correlation parameter of Kirkwood has been applied to the derivation of the local field in liquids1. Onsager´s formula for the dielectric constant was obtained on the basis of a point dipole model superimposed on a rigid molecular sphere assuming a uniform radial distribution outside the sphere. Alternatively, on assuming a lattice structure, Van Vleck´s formula was derived.
